Creative activities help children reflect on their personal experiences while also learning to consider other viewpoints. The 11 robust units for fifth grade include inspirational stories, creative writing prompts, video journals, hands-on art activities, interviews, song writing, creating a dance, and more.

These culturally responsive teaching lessons help teachers learn more about their students and connect learning experiences in the classroom to students' lives. Set your classroom up for learning success with Culturally Responsive Lessons and Activities for grade 5.

What's Inside
Each teacher's resource book includes 11 units with theme-based activities, plus reproducible student resources.

The eight nonfiction, informational fiction, and realistic fiction story units include:

  • Inspirational stories that describe an authentic life experience and help students learn about different perspectives
  • Theme-based activities that prompt students to think about their own experiences and consider other viewpoints
  • Project menus that allow students to choose from a selection of activities such as interviews, creative writing, art projects, video presentations, and more.

The three cultural exploration and self-discovery units include:

  • Creative games and activities that invite students to reflect on their own cultures and interactions with the world
  • Collaborative whole-class projects that help students consider other viewpoints

Reproducible student resources include:

  • "How do I say it?" sentence starter guide
  • Student and parent sharing form to build home and school connections

The theme-based topics for fifth grade include: Let's Celebrate Who We Are, Food is a Part of Culture, Class Book

144 reproducible pages. Includes answer key.
